Signal Current Measurement (MXL2 Locator only)
Signal Current Measurement can also help to identify the layout of pipe and cable networks
as the main line after a 'T' will have most of the Signal Current remaining on it whereas the
shorter connection will have correspondingly less.
The Signal Current reading should also reduce at a uniform rate as the distance from the
Generator/ Transmitter increases. A sudden drop in Signal Current, in a short distance,
indicates a change to that service such as an unknown connection, an insulated joint or
a break in the pipe or cable.
